A new report from the EASI ZERo project defines performance specifications for seven innovative bio-based building envelope materials being developed for sustainable renovations across Europe. The EU-funded EASI ZERo project has been launched to develop an envelope system of bio-based and recycled materials for efficient building renovation to achieve near zero energy balance and CO2 emissions.
